    Since its genesis in 1940, Piedmont Aviation has continued a proud heritage of professionalism and excellence. Piedmont provides world-class MRO services to the commercial, regional and military sectors of the industry. Primary products include overhaul/repair of APUs (as a Honeywell authorized service center) and overhaul/repair of regional aircraft landing gear. Our shops are fully supported by an extensive, in-house capability that includes machining, grinding, electroplating and shot-peening.
